Why Convert Word to PDF?
- Preserved Formatting: PDF (Portable Document Format) maintains the original layout, fonts, and images of your Word document, ensuring that it looks the same on any device or operating system.
- Enhanced Security: PDFs can be password-protected, restricting access and preventing unauthorized modifications. This is crucial for sensitive documents.
- Universal Compatibility: PDF is a widely supported format, making it accessible to almost anyone, regardless of the software they have installed.
- Smaller File Size: Often, converting a Word document to PDF can reduce the file size, making sharing and storage easier.
How to Convert Word to PDF Online
Several online tools are available to convert your Word documents to PDF quickly and easily. Here's a simple guide using Soda PDF, a popular online converter:
Step-by-Step Guide
- Upload Your Word Document:
- Go to the Soda PDF Word to PDF converter.
- Click the "Choose File" button.
- Select your Word document from your computer, Google Drive, or Dropbox. You can also drag and drop the file into the designated area.
- Conversion Process: The tool will automatically start converting your Word document to PDF format.
- Download Your PDF: Once the conversion is complete, you will be prompted to download the PDF file to your computer or save it to your online file storage account.
